The Case for Decentralization: Speed, Precision, and Resilience

Traditional hierarchical models, where decisions trickle down from the top, are increasingly ill-suited for today's volatile markets. Decentralized management flips this paradigm, placing authority closer to the action. Consider Acme Industries, a global automotive components leader. By granting mid-level managers access to predictive analytics and real-time production data,

slashed machine downtime by 25% and boosted production speed by 30%. This wasn't just a technical upgrade—it was a cultural shift. Managers became problem-solvers, not just executors, enabling rapid adjustments to supply chain disruptions and quality issues.

Similarly, e&, a multinational tech and investment group, saw a 15% improvement in market responsiveness by decentralizing strategy execution. Regional teams adapted global frameworks to local conditions, a critical advantage in fragmented markets. The result? Faster product launches, better customer alignment, and a 12% increase in operational profitability.

Academic research corroborates these outcomes. A 2024 extension of the Stoner and Freeman (1995) decision-making model highlights how decentralized structures foster iterative refinement through feedback loops. In volatile environments, this agility is a lifeline.

Technology as the Enabler: AI, IoT, and Blockchain

Decentralization isn't just about organizational charts—it's about democratizing data. Technologies like AI, IoT, and blockchain are the backbone of this transformation.

  • Tesla's AI-driven factories reduced unplanned downtime by 40%, enabling decentralized teams to preemptively address bottlenecks.
  • Caterpillar and BASF use blockchain to autonomously adjust procurement and logistics, cutting lead times by 30%.
  • Siemens' AR-based maintenance systems cut error rates by 18%, while 3M and Honeywell train managers in UXRP (User Experience in Resource Planning) to maximize tool adoption.

These innovations create a flywheel effect: better data leads to faster decisions, which drive operational excellence. For investors, the key is to identify firms that integrate these technologies not as buzzwords but as strategic enablers.

Balancing Autonomy with Alignment: The Governance Challenge

Decentralization isn't without risks. Fragmented strategies and data silos can erode long-term value. The solution? Governance frameworks that balance autonomy with accountability.

NextEra Energy, for instance, decentralized renewable energy allocation decisions while maintaining strict compliance with environmental regulations. This hybrid model improved grid efficiency by 20% without compromising sustainability goals. Similarly, a global fashion brand used AI to empower buyers as “visionaries,” aligning data-driven insights with creative strategies to boost customer satisfaction by 15% and generate $80 million in incremental sales.

Investors should look for companies with clear metrics:
- Production speed and downtime reduction (e.g., Acme's 30% gain).
- Supply chain responsiveness (e.g., Caterpillar's 30% lead time cut).
- Employee engagement (e.g., a life sciences firm reduced turnover by 25% through decentralized coaching).
